Overview of an E Rickshaw Lithium Ion Battery

An li ion battery for e rickshaw is an integral component of electric rickshaws that powers their electric propulsion system.

  1. Energy Storage: E-rickshaw lithium-ion batteries store electrical energy chemically for efficient powering of the electric motor that drives the vehicle. They feature high energy density levels to store significant power within an easily transportable package.
  2. Types: E-rickshaws utilize various lithium-ion battery types, with common variations being lithium iron phosphate (LiFePO4 or LFP), lithium manganese oxide (LiMn2O4 or LMO), and lithium nickel manganese cobalt oxide (LiNiMnCoO2 or NMC). Each has unique properties, such as energy density, cycle life, thermal stability, and overall cost considerations that impact its performance and cost-efficiency.
  3. Voltage and Capacity: E-rickshaw lithium-ion batteries come in different voltage and capacity configurations to suit different models and requirements, typically 48V to 72V, with capacities ranging from several Kilowatt-Hours (kWh) up to larger packs for extended driving ranges.
  4. Durability: Modern lithium-ion batteries are engineered to last, capable of withstanding thousands of charge/discharge cycles without frequent replacement, thus saving money and time by eliminating frequent replacement needs.

Benefits of using Li-ion batteries for E-rickshaws

Li-ion batteries have become an increasingly popular choice for powering e-rickshaws due to their many advantages. We previously examined this topic.

  1. Energy Density: Li-ion batteries boast higher energy densities than traditional lead-acid batteries, which can store more power in a smaller and lighter package, providing increased efficiency and longer driving range for e-rickshaws.
  2. Lightweight: Li-ion batteries are significantly lighter than lead-acid ones, helping reduce the overall weight of an e-rickshaw for improved handling, acceleration, and energy efficiency. This results in better maneuverability as well as greater energy savings over time.
  3. Fast Charging: Li-ion batteries support fast charging, enabling e-rickshaw drivers to quickly recharge their vehicles for the daily operation of an e-rickshaw fleet. Fast charging helps reduce downtime while optimizing the daily operations of these rickshaws.
  4. Longevity: Modern Li-ion batteries are designed for long service lives, with the capacity to endure thousands of charge/discharge cycles without frequent replacement needs, significantly cutting maintenance costs for e-rickshaw operators.
  5. Reduced Maintenance: Li-ion batteries require less maintenance than lead-acid batteries, eliminating regular water topping-up or equalization charging procedures and creating lower operating costs and reduced hassle for e-rickshaw owners.
  6. Efficiency: Li-ion batteries are highly energy-efficient, wasting minimal power during charging and discharging cycles to achieve improved overall efficiency and lower energy costs for e-rickshaw operators.
  7. Safety features: Li-ion batteries come equipped with safety features such as thermal management systems and protection circuits to minimize risks such as overheating, overcharging, and short-circuiting – thus improving overall e-rickshaw operations’ safety.
  8. Environmental Benefits: Li-ion batteries produce no tailpipe emissions, creating a cleaner and more sustainable urban environment. They help decrease air pollution and greenhouse gas emissions associated with e-rickshaw transportation.
